Ingredients
Ingredients for Almond Butter Protein Balls
- 1 cup almond butter
- 1/2 cup rolled oats
- 1/4 cup honey or maple syrup
- 1/4 cup protein powder (vanilla or chocolate)
- 1/2 cup dark chocolate chips
- 1/4 cup chopped nuts (optional)
- 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
- Pinch of salt
Instructions
Mix Ingredients
In a large bowl, combine almond butter, rolled oats, honey, protein powder, chocolate chips, chopped nuts,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t. Stir until well combined.
Form Balls
Using your hands, form the mixture into small balls, about 1 inch in diameter.
Chill and Serve
Place the balls on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to firm up. Enjoy as a healthy snack!
Storage Tips
To keep your Almond Butter Protein Balls fresh,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. This will help maintain their firmness and flavor. If you prefer, you can also freeze them for longer storage. Just make sure to separate each ball with parchment paper before placing them in a freezer-safe bag or container, allowing you to grab one whenever you need a quick snack.
When stored properly, these protein balls can last in the refrigerator for up to a week, and in the freezer, they can stay fresh for up to three months. This makes them an excellent choice for meal prepping and having healthy snacks on hand at all times.

Questions About Recipes
→ Can I use another nut butter?
Yes, you can substitute almond butter with peanut butter or cashew butter for different flavors.
→ How long do these protein balls last?
They can be stored in the refrigerator for up to a week or frozen for longer storage.
→ Can I add more ingredients?
Absolutely! Feel free to add dried fruits, seeds, or other mix-ins to customize your protein balls.
→ Are these suitable for vegans?
Yes, if you use maple syrup instead of honey, these protein balls are vegan-friendly.

Nutritional Breakdown (Per Serving)
- Calories: 150 kcal
- Total Fat: 8g
- Saturated Fat: 1g
- Cholesterol: 0mg
- Sodium: 5mg
- Total Carbohydrates: 16g
- Dietary Fiber: 2g
- Sugars: 6g
- Protein: 5g
